The Dayton Board of Realtors is pleased to announce the appointment of Conrad Echemann as the new Chairman of the Industrial/Commercial Committee. Echemann brings a wealth of experience and a proven track record in the real estate industry, making him a pivotal addition to the leadership team.
As the new chairman, Echemann will lead the committee in fostering growth and innovation within the industrial and commercial real estate sectors. His appointment reflects the Board’s commitment to driving strategic initiatives that support the evolving needs of the Dayton business community and their drive to bring new and upcoming realtors to the leadership positions.
Echemann, a seasoned real estate professional, has been an active member of the Dayton Board of Realtors since beginning his career. His extensive background includes successful projects across multiple sectors, from industrial developments to commercial leasing. His vision for the Industrial/Commercial Committee includes strengthening partnerships, advocating for policy improvements, and promoting sustainable development.
“I am honored to take on this role and work alongside such a dedicated team,” said Echemann. “Together, we will continue to build a vibrant, thriving real estate landscape that benefits the entire Dayton community.”
